摘要

X-ray absorption spectra(XAS) at Mn K-edge and Fe K-edge in LaMn1-x Fe x O3show that with the increase of Fe substitution the chemical valence of Mn4+decreases,while the chemical valence of Fe3+remains unchanged.Structural distortions,such as the rotating and tilting for oxygen octahedron in the unit cell vary with iron content.A phase transition occurs at the Fe content values of 0.2~0.3.The evolutions of rotation and tilting angle of FeO6/MnO6octahedral may be the vital factors to the structure and magnetism.We believe that the spin configuration of Fe3+may vary from the intermediate spin t42g e1g(S = 3/2) to the higher spin t32g e2g(S = 5/2) near the phase transition.
